Explorer advertisements in new tabs
Explorer 7.0.6000.16643, Dell XPS M2010, Vista, McAfee, Office 2007 Whenever I open Explorer, my home page comes up fine (I have changed home pages and my problem still exists). As soon as I begin a search in any homepage, a new tab pops up withadvertisements. This is not a pop up window, just a new tab next to the one I am using. I spoke with McAfee and was told I possess all their software offers andhave run all scans possible. I could live with this, but a new tab adds every couple of hours while I am in the middle of working. It overrides whatever I am doing, takingme to the new advertisement. I appreciate any assistance you may offer.
